I don't know why I bother but Finley is not getting paid $21 million by Cuban this year. When he was waived his money was defered in $5 million dollar installments. Cuban will be paying him that until he's like 40 years old.
Obviously Finley isn't hurting for money but I don't understand why people keep thinking he's making $24 ($21 from Cuban, $3 million from the Spurs) million this year.
